Abstract

Background: Shared governance is a model in which staff collaborate through a decentralized decision making structure, sharing ownership and accountability and partnering to make decisions about clinical practice,  professional development, patient safety and quality improvement. Aim: of this study was to investigate the effect of shared governance educational program on knowledge, perceptions and autonomy of professional nurses. Design: A quasi-experimental research was utilized. Setting: The study was carried out in five of Minia University Hospitals including the Main University Hospital; Gynecology, Obstetrics and Pediatrics Hospital; Cardio-Thoracic Hospital; Renal and Urology Hospital in addition to the Dental Hospital. Subjects: Participants of the study were a probability sample of professional nurses (no=78) drained from the total baccalaureate-prepared nurses who were working in the previously mentioned Hospitals at the study conduction period. Tools: Two tools were used; Nurses Knowledge and Perceptions of Shared Governance Questionnaire, and Professional Nursing Autonomy Scale. Results: There was a high statistically significant improvement in the level of nurses’ knowledge and perceptions of shared governance as well as in their level of perceived professional autonomy from its three perspectives at all test measures that followed implementing the educational program than what was before program implementation. Conclusion: The educational intervention carried out within the context of this study was successful at improving the knowledge, perceptions and autonomy of professional nurses. Recommendations: This study especially emphasize that continuing education is a consolidated way to ensure the implementation of shared governance and promotes professional nursing autonomy.

Introduction

Governance is a topic that should be explored in the management research field in general and nursing and health management specifically. It can help increase nurses’ autonomy and scope of responsibilities. In the health care area, the use of the term governance has been growing, especially in the context of discussions about good management practices that could be adopted to improve care delivery for individuals and population. A principle of governance is the participation and involvement of professionals in management and decision making process at organizations and health services, these professionals should be as committed as his/her managers with results of care to be achieved (Santos et al., 2013).

The changing context of society and healthcare called for a restructuring of hospital administration that emphasized collaboration, a defined knowledge base, autonomous practice, and shared decision making. Moreover, nurses are the closest to patients and the point of care. They hold scientific knowledge upon which to provide care across the continuum of healthcare services. Furthermore, nurses have the unique ability to partner with other health care professional in redesigning the healthcare system (Charland, 2015).

In the context of nursing, professional governance corresponds to the processes and structures that provide autonomy, control and authority to nurses regarding the nursing practices within an organization (Barden et al., 2012). The first governance model for nursing was designed in the 1980s, in the United States, and called “shared governance” (Hess & Swihart, 2013; Santos et al., 2013). The model is based on the assumption that nurses, as the main frontline health workers, are more qualified to assess and decide which are the care needs of patients, based on parameters of clinical practice guidelines (Barden et al., 2012; Hess & Swihart, 2013).

Shared governance is seen as a strategy to build a partnership, create ownership, and facilitate equity and accountability between the nurses and the work environment (Al-Faouri et al., 2014). As a management innovation, shared governance implementation was a strategy to enhance professional nursing practice to transform the organization from a bureaucratic, hierarchy to a more organic, relational partnership (Charland, 2015).

Autonomy has been described as having the authority to make independent decisions and to take actions in accordance with one’s discretion and professional knowledge. To function autonomously, however, nurses must develop the expertise that allows them to exercise sound clinical judgment and exert control over their practice. Certain satisfiers must be met, for example, resources must be provided and autonomy supported to achieve an adequate level of competency (Shepherd et al., 2014).

Tools of data collection:

Two tools were used to collect the research data for this study as follows: -

 

Tool 1: Nurses Knowledge and Perceptions of Shared Governance Questionnaire.  It was consisted of three parts:

 

Part I: included the socio-demographiccharacteristics of the study sample as (age, gender, place of residence, current job position, years of experience and work department).

 

Part II: included 20 items developed by the researcher based on the literature reviewto identify nurses' knowledge of shared governance with 2 responses (1) I don’t know and (2) Yes I know. Total score of knowledge (˃ 60%) considered "satisfactory" level and otherwise considered "unsatisfactory" level.  

 

Part III: included 18-items adapted by the researcherfrom (Rundquist, 2014) to measure nurses' perceptions of shared governance on 3-point Likert scale ranged from (1) disagree, (2) neutral and (3) agree. The score was reversed for negative items. Total scores of (18-30) indicate "low", while scores (31- 42) considered "moderate" and scores (43-54) considered "high" level of perceptions. The higher score indicated that shared governance is perceived as favorable administrative system by the group of participated nurses.

 

 

Tool 2: Professional Nursing Autonomy Scale:

This tool was adapted by the researcher from the instrument originally developed by(Blegen, 1993) and used by (Mrayyan, 2005) to measure nurses' autonomy over patient care and unit operations decisions on a 5-point Likert scale ranging from (1) "Nurses have no authority nor accountability" to (5) "Nurses have full independent authority and accountability".  Total score of the scale ranged from (41 - 205) with scores of (41 - 95) indicated that participated nurses perceived their professional autonomy as "low" and from (96 - 150) indicated "moderate", while from (151 - 205) indicated "high" level of autonomy.

 

Validity of Tools

 Tools of the study were translated into Arabic by the researcher. Its content validity were revised and validated by a panel of five experts in nursing administration field including Two Assistant Professors in Nursing Administration Department – Faculty of Nursing – Minia University and Two Assistant Professors in Nursing Administration Department – Faculty of Nursing – Ain-Shams University in addition to One Assistant Professor in Nursing Administration Department – Faculty of Nursing – Beni-Suief University.  Accordingly, wording of some items were modified.

 

Reliability of Tools    

The reliability analysis of the study tools was done using alpha coefficient to measure the stability of its internal consistency; it was (0.72) for nurses knowledge and perceptions of shared governance questionnaire, while the test value for the autonomy scale was (0.89).

 

Pilot Study

A pilot study was done on 10% of participants (8 nurses) who were included in the study sample. They were selected randomly from the five hospitals where the study was carried out in order to check the applicability of tools, identify obstacles and problems that may be encountered during data collection and the estimate time needed to fill the questionnaires. In the light of the pilot study’ findings, no major changes occurred in the tools’ content or no. of items. So, tools were put in its final form.

Discussion

Education on shared governance principles, concepts, competencies, roles, council structure, and processes were vital to the implementation and integration of shared governance and set the pace for its success (Shepherd et al., 2014).  On the other side, autonomy is a critical aspect of professional practice and never more so than when considering professional nurses who embrace an entire range of tasks, skills, and practices within their profession (Bassett & Miller, 2017).

The findings of the present study revealed a high statistically significant improvement in the level of nurses’ knowledge and perceptions of shared governance at all test measures that followed implementing the educational program (post, 1st & 2nd follow-up tests) than that of before program implementation (pre-test). This result reflects the implications of successfulness of shared governance educational program.in achieving a high level of professional autonomy among nursing staff as evident from the positive change that was found between pre-test / post-test measures.

­This result, reported by the present study, was in harmony with results of the study conducted by (Rundquist,  2014) which demonstrated a statistically significant change in the participants’ knowledge and perceptions from pre-test to post-test. This result was also in line with (Glasscock, 2012) who revealed that, the mean overall governance score in his study increased at post-implementation of a governance structure than pre-implementation.

The result of the present study indicated that there were significant differences in overall level of nurses' knowledge and perceptions of shared governance between the pretest and the three measuring times after the program implementation. This was though by the increase of total mean score of knowledge and perceptions level immediately after program implementation than the level that was before implementing the educational program. However,  the level of nurses' knowledge and perceptions slightly decreased after three and sixth months later from implementing the program with statistically significant difference.

From researcher point of view, the changes in professional nurses' knowledge and perceptions of shared governance after implementing the training program might be attributed to the refreshment and broadening of their knowledge base as a result of what they learned and gained of knowledge about the concept of shared governance as a new approach of administrative structure through the new concepts and principles added and clarified within the different sessions of the educational program

In addition, the clarification and distinguishing of the different concepts such decisional involvement, participation, participatory management, shared leadership and team work which commonly confused in meaning with the concept of shared governance may also considered as a contributing factor to the increased knowledge and perceptions levels. While, the slight decrease in knowledge and perceptions of shared governance noted in the two follow-up attempts could be attributed to what was forgotten from essential information that hoped to be compensated by the given Arabic booklet as a handouts about the program contents.
